I was wondering if the bug that was fixed mid-last-year to make "--diff" 
work correctly with blockinfile can be backported to 2.3.x?  It is in 2.4.x 
but I can't upgrade to 2.4.x yet because it dropped support for Python 2.4 
servers, and I still have ~35 RHEL5 systems that I need to support -- 
probably until the end of this calendar year.  Using a 3rd-party Python 
doesn't really work with a lot of things like Yum.  I use blockinfile a 
lot, but makes me nervous to always push-out changes without being able to 
see what will actually change in a dry run first in check mode.

This is the bug:
https://github.com/ansible/ansible/issues/23198
